Acne Treatment Market – Segmentations
Global acne treatment market, as reported by MRFR, can be segmented on the foundation of type, treatment, treatment modality, and end-users. Such an extensive research is loaded with detailed analysis of various factors that can impact the global market in the coming years.
By type, the acne treatment market includes cystic acne, post-surgical/wound acne, comedonal acne, inflammatory acne, and others. The inflammatory acne segment is gaining substantial boost.
By treatment, the acne treatment market includes therapeutic devices, medication, and others. The medication segment encompasses antibiotics, retinoid, and others. The retinoid segment holds tretinoin, adapalene, and others under its purview. The antibiotics segment encompasses clindamycin, erythromycin, and others. The therapeutic devices segment has microdermabrader, lasers, dermabradors, and others.
By treatment modality, the acne treatment market covers oral, topical, and injectable. The topical segment is all set to find better market penetration in the coming years.
By end-users, the acne treatment industry trends encompasses pharmacies & drug stores, hospitals & clinics, ambulatory surgical centers, and others. The pharmacies & drug stores segment is deemed to receive significant thrust from the regional market.

Acne Treatment Industry/Innovation/ Related News:
February 14, 2019 — Rodan & Fields, LLC (North America), a manufacturer and multi-level marketing company specializing in skincare products launched its new game-changing Acne System, named Spotless. This all-new targeted system can treat two very different kinds of acne.
March 07, 2019 — Foamix Pharmaceuticals (the US), a leading global Pharmaceutical company announced that the FDA has accepted NDA for its acne treatment – FMX101. The FDA’s acceptance of its marketing application seeking approval for FMX101, a topical minocyline foam, for the treatment of non-nodular, moderate-to-severe inflammatory lesions of acne vulgaris in patients is due for the action by October 20, 2019.
August 04, 2018 – Enter Acropass (South Korea), a leading provider of Acne Removal Products and Skin Care Acne Treatment launched a new kind of at-home microneedle technology to treat skin breakouts.
The technology using small, circular strips, send tiny dissolvable pressure point needles that are made with hyaluronic acid and niacinamide, into the skin penetrating the surface to infuse faster-working anti-inflammatory agents and dramatically reduce the circumference and life of a spot.
August 03, 2018 – Researchers at pharmaceutical and skin-care company – Galderma S.A. (Switzerland) published their study of a new class of retinoids called trifarotene, which they claim could be more effective at topically treating acne with fewer side effects.
Ongoing clinical studies conducted on trifarotene cream have demonstrated the efficacy of the treatment on both the face and the body.
July 17, 2018 – Zydus Cadila (US), a pharmaceutical company announced receiving the final approval from the US health regulator to market Clindamycin Phosphate Topical Solution, used to treat acne. The company had already received approval from the US Food and Drug Administration (USFDA) to sell Clindamycin Phosphate products such as Topical Solution USP (Cleocin T), 1 percent. Clindamycin, an antibiotic is used to treat acne by stopping the growth of bacteria and it also helps to decrease the number of acne lesions
